“Resistant” is Michael Palmer’s newest book. Dr, Lou Welcome’s best friend, Cap Duncan, injures his leg while running. Surgeons manage to save the leg but the open wound is the perfect breeding ground for a deadly microbial invader committed to eating Cap alive from the inside out. The germ is resistant to any known antibiotic. Turning to the Center of Disease Control for help, Lou discovers a link to a group known as the “One Hundred Neighbors” who will stop at nothing to further its agenda – even deadly germs.
